A U.S. Air Force C-130J Super Hercules assigned to the 774th Expeditionary Airlift Squadron has cargo downloaded at an undisclosed location August, 2, 2019. The C-130J is capable of operating from rough, dirt strips and is the primary transport for airdropping troops and equipment into hostile areas. The flexible design enables it to be configured for many different missions, allowing one aircraft to perform the role of many.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Keifer Bowes)
